Photo Description:

Gosaikunda, also spelled Gosainkunda and Gosain Kunda is an alpine freshwater oligotrophic lake in Nepal’s Langtang National Park, located at an altitude of 4,380 m (14,370 ft) above sea level in the Rasuwa District with a surface of 13.8 ha (34 acres).

Together with associated lakes, the Gosaikunda Lake complex is 1,030 ha (4.0 sq mi) in size and has been designated a Ramsar site in September 2007. The lake melts and sips down to form the Trishuli river and remains frozen for six months in winter October to June. There are 108 lakes in this area, small to medium in size. The challenging Lauribina La pass at an altitude of 4,610 m (15,120 ft) is on its outskirts.

After a long trek from Kyanjing Gompa to Bamboo, Gosaikunda was the final destination. A hard but shortcut trail from Bamboo to MukKharka to Cholan pati to Lauribanayak in one day was a tough hike ever in my life. The above picture was shot on Friday Morning from the North-East side of Gosaikunda.

  4. Langtang, Gosainkunda to Helambu Trekking
    This classical trek combines three major areas north-east of Kathmandu along the border of Tibet Langtang, Gosainkunda and Helambu and the major inhabitants of the region are Sherpa and Tamang who share a similar religion, language and clothing style. While continuing the journey we pass through the sacred lakes of Gosainkunda (4380m), a pilgrimage spot where, during the full moon festival of August, flow hundreds of pilgrims.
    This trek offers an opportunity to explore villages, to climb small peaks and to visit glaciers at a comfortably low elevation. There are about 108 lakes or kund (in Nepali) in this area and mainly visible from the routes are Saraswati Kund, Bhairab Kund, Surya Kund and Gosainkunda is the famous and most important one. During this trek we can have excellent views of snowy mountain peaks, like the Langtang Lirung (7,246 m.). Gangchenpo (5,846 m.) and Dorje Lakpa (6,966 m.).
